SUNY completes mandatory Thanksgiving exit testing of on-campus students, chancellor says

Two days before Thanksgiving, State University of New York Chancellor Jim Malatras announced that SUNY campuses have finished mandatory testing of students on campus with 152,788 tests conducted with a positivity rate of 0.63 percent between November 9 and November 23. Democrats claim victory in four close legislative races

As more absentee and mail-in ballots are counted across New York state, many close races are being called.
